The New York
Central Coach Yard job switches a passenger train consist on the
westbound main track in front of the Jackson depot in the 1950's.
The depot's Coach Yard job handled the interchange of branch line
passenger cars with main line trains bound for Detroit and Chicago.
At one time, six MC and NYC branch lines fanned out from Jackson,
all with connecting passenger trains.
